See e.g.: http://www.oreilly.de/catalog/docbook/chapter/book/ch01.html In XML, the numeric character number is always the Unicode character number. In addition, XML allows hexadecimal numeric character references of the form &#xhhhh;. In SGML, the numeric character number is a number from the document character set that's declared in the SGML declaration. -- Michiel Meeuwissen mihxil' Mediacentrum 140 H'sum [] () +31 (0)35 6772979 nl_NL eo_XX en_US
